Upload local files to an Apps Script project ## Usage ```bash gws apps-script +push --script ``` ## Flags | Flag | Required | Default | Description | |------|----------|---------|-------------| | `--script` | ✓ | — | Script Project ID | | `--dir` | — | — | Directory containing script files (defaults to current dir) | ## Examples ```bash gws script +push --script SCRIPT_ID gws script +push --script SCRIPT_ID --dir ./src ``` ## Tips - Supports .gs, .js, .html, and appsscript.json files. - Skips hidden files and node_modules automatically. - This replaces ALL files in the project. > [!CAUTION] > This is a **write** command — confirm with the user before executing. ## See Also - [gws-shared](../gws-shared/SKILL.md) — Global flags and auth - [gws-apps-script](../gws-apps-script/SKILL.md) — All manage and execute apps script projects commands
